Output bf3181c29d325438b0f30bd63e99c79f2c58fef3da8e47cf150722dc29e9cbb2:0

value
641868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e31bd7ec54d97e34652664392e5e6c08509ad7ed OP_EQUAL
address
3NPrfgkCeyNH6LrbjzLFZCpwGsW1h9CFuz
transaction
bf3181c29d325438b0f30bd63e99c79f2c58fef3da8e47cf150722dc29e9cbb2
spent
true